SDI Rescue Diver
Ready to become the diver others can count on? The SDI Rescue Diver course is one of the most rewarding steps in your dive journey. You’ll learn how to recognize and prevent problems before they happen, manage real-world dive emergencies, and perform rescues with confidence. From self-rescue skills to helping a buddy in distress, this course builds both your competence and your confidence underwater. It’s challenging, empowering, and a crucial step toward becoming a true dive leader.

Course combination
This course can be combined with the Adult, Child and Infant Emergency Care and Oxygen Administration course.
The package price for the course combination would be €599,-.

Course prerequisites
- Minimum age of 10 years old.(10 through 17 years with parental consent)
- Certified SDI Advanced Adventure Diver or equivalent; advanced certification must include verifiable experience in deep, navigation, night, and limited visibility specialties.
- Provide proof of current First Response Adult and Child Emergency Care Provider and Oxygen Administration Provider (where local law permits) certification or equivalent.
- Minimum of 15 logged open water dives.
- Divers under age 15 may earn the Junior Rescue Diver certification. Junior students are to train and dive under the direct supervision of a parent, guardian, or active dive professional.
